22K Yellow GoldLeaf Topcoat
over Precision Nail Lacquer Call Me Pumpkin
I originally wanted to use this over a dark green since gold and green is one of my favorite combinations, but I thought it would be nice with a good pumpkin orange shade as well. I really like this combination, and I'm looking forward to wearing the top coat with other colours too! I used two coats of the goldleaf top coat over three coats of Precision's Call Me Pumpkin.

12K White Goldleaf Topcoat over Precision Nail Lacquer Sage
I tend to wear more white gold than yellow, and I love being able to add the bling onto my nails. I used one coat of the white goldleaf topcoat over two coats of Precision Sage.
